'=========================================================================
' Reverse Polish Notation (RPN) Evaluator Programmed by William Yu (01/97)
'
'            Infix Notation : 4 + (3 - 2) * 9 ^ 2
'   Equivalent Postfix (RPN): 4 3 2 - 9 2 ^ * +
'
' Please check ALGOR.ABC for the useful INFIX TO POSTFIX (RPN) CONVERTER.
' Both demonstrate the fundamentals and uses of stacks.
'=========================================================================

DECLARE FUNCTION EmptyStack% (Stack AS INTEGER)
DECLARE SUB POP (Stack AS INTEGER, Element AS DOUBLE)
DECLARE SUB GetNextToken (RPNExp AS STRING, Position AS INTEGER, Token AS ANY, TokenItem AS STRING)
DECLARE SUB PUSH (Stack AS INTEGER, Element AS DOUBLE)
DECLARE FUNCTION Evaluate# (RPNExp AS STRING)
DEFINT A-Z

CONST FALSE = 0
CONST TRUE = NOT FALSE

' Token item
CONST Operand = 1         ' TIP: Use descriptive identifiers };-)
CONST Operator = 2        ' So you don't have to waste time documenting.
CONST Bad = 3
CONST Finished = 4

'Error codes
CONST None = 0
CONST FewOperands = 1
CONST FewOperator = 2
CONST Invalid = 3
CONST NoResult = 4

CONST Max = 100      ' # of items (operands only) to fill stack until full

DIM RPNExp AS STRING
DIM SHARED Element(1 TO Max) AS DOUBLE
DIM SHARED ErrorCode

' One heck of an expression :)
' Needs
'WIDTH 80, 43
' to view all the steps
' End the expression with ; (semi-colon)

RPNExp = "+4.546 2.6734^ 5656 -438.390 /* 6234  -234 99*564- 23 432 457 234 *+/*-+;"

' Other examples to uncomment.  Create one!
'RPNExp = "4 6 +;"
'RPNExp = "-34.3 345 / 345 -345* 45 +-;"
'RPNExp = "45.345 -.345*;"
'RPNExp = "34 8 ^ 85 10 + *;"

CLS
PRINT "Expression is: "; RPNExp

Number# = Evaluate(RPNExp)
IF ErrorCode = None THEN
  PRINT "Expression Value is:"; Number#
ELSE
  PRINT : PRINT "*** BAD EXPRESSION : ";
  SELECT CASE ErrorCode
    CASE FewOperands
      PRINT "Too few operands. ***"
    CASE FewOperator
      PRINT "Too few operators. ***"
    CASE Invalid
      PRINT "Invalid input (bad character) ***"
    CASE NoResult
      PRINT "Nothing to evaluate! ***"
  END SELECT
END IF

FUNCTION EmptyStack (Stack AS INTEGER)
'----------------------------------------------
'  Simply checks if stack is empty
'----------------------------------------------

  EmptyStack = FALSE
  IF Stack = 0 THEN EmptyStack = TRUE

END FUNCTION

FUNCTION Evaluate# (RPNExp AS STRING)
'----------------------------------------------
'  Evaluate the RPN Expression
'----------------------------------------------

DIM TokenItem AS STRING
DIM Number AS DOUBLE, Number2 AS DOUBLE

   Position = 1      ' Parse string from position 1
   Stack = 0         ' Initialize Stack, ie. make it empty
   ErrorCode = None

   DO
     GetNextToken RPNExp, Position, Token, TokenItem
     PRINT "TOKEN = "; TokenItem;
     SELECT CASE Token
       CASE Operand
         Number = VAL(TokenItem)
         PRINT "  PUSH = "; Number
         PUSH Stack, Number
       CASE Operator
         POP Stack, Number
         IF EmptyStack(Stack) THEN ErrorCode = FewOperands: EXIT DO
         POP Stack, Number2
         PRINT "  POP ="; Number; " POP ="; Number2
         SELECT CASE TokenItem
           CASE "+"
             Number = Number + Number2
           CASE "-"
             Number = Number2 - Number
           CASE "*"
             Number = Number * Number2
           CASE "/"
             Number = Number2 / Number
           CASE "^"
             Number = Number2 ^ Number
         END SELECT
         PUSH Stack, Number
         PRINT " PUSH ="; Number
       CASE Finished
         IF EmptyStack(Stack) THEN
           ErrorCode = NoResult
         ELSE
           POP Stack, Number
           PRINT " POP ="; Number
         END IF
       CASE Bad
         ErrorCode = Invalid
         EXIT DO
     END SELECT
   LOOP UNTIL Token = Finished
   IF NOT EmptyStack(Stack) THEN ErrorCode = FewOperator

   Evaluate# = Number

END FUNCTION

SUB GetNextToken (RPNExp AS STRING, Position AS INTEGER, Token AS INTEGER, TokenItem AS STRING)
'------------------------------------------------------------------------
'  Parse Expression until a token (Operand/Operator/EndOfExpr) is found.
'------------------------------------------------------------------------

  Start = Position
  Done = FALSE
  Token = Finished
  Numbers$ = "0123456789."
  Signs$ = " +-*/^"

  DO
    Char$ = MID$(RPNExp, Position, 1)
    SELECT CASE Char$
      CASE "0" TO "9", "."
        Token = Operand
        Check$ = MID$(RPNExp, Position + 1, 1)
        Check = FALSE
        FOR I = 1 TO LEN(Signs$)
          IF Check$ = MID$(Signs$, I, 1) THEN Check = TRUE
        NEXT I
        IF Check THEN Done = TRUE
      CASE " "
        Start = Start + 1
      CASE "+", "-"
        Check$ = MID$(RPNExp, Position + 1, 1)
        Check = FALSE
        FOR I = 1 TO LEN(Numbers$)
          IF Check$ = MID$(Numbers$, I, 1) THEN Check = TRUE
        NEXT I
        IF Check THEN                   ' Check for strings like 123+123
          IF Token = Operand THEN       ' which is not valid.
            Token = Bad                 ' (Where + can be any operator)
            Done = TRUE
          ELSE                          ' Although you can have -123
            Token = Operand             ' so we continue to parse...
          END IF
        ELSE                            ' Else it's 123+ or just +
          Token = Operator              ' So we perform the operation.
          Done = TRUE                   ' (Again, + can be any operator)
        END IF
      CASE "*", "/", "^"
        Token = Operator
        Done = TRUE
      CASE ";"
        Done = TRUE
        Token = Finished
      CASE ELSE
        Token = Bad
        Done = TRUE
    END SELECT
    Position = Position + 1
  LOOP UNTIL Done OR Position > LEN(RPNExp)
 
  TokenItem = MID$(RPNExp, Start, Position - Start)

END SUB

SUB POP (Stack AS INTEGER, Element AS DOUBLE)
'----------------------------------------------
'  Return the top element on the stack.
'----------------------------------------------

IF Stack = 0 THEN
  PRINT " *** Attempt to pop from an empty stack ***"
ELSE
  Element = Element(Stack)
  Stack = Stack - 1
END IF

END SUB

SUB PUSH (Stack AS INTEGER, Element AS DOUBLE)
'----------------------------------------------
'  Fill stack with Element
'----------------------------------------------

Stack = Stack + 1
IF Stack > Max THEN
  PRINT " *** Attempt to push on a full stack ***"
ELSE
  Element(Stack) = Element
END IF

END SUB
